Three questions: 1) After DeKalifornicating my KLR-650 today I noticed one long hose apparently coming from the carb or thereabouts running back along the top of the subframe and going under the rear fender. It looks like a black hose, not one of the colored ones like in Mark St Hilaire's DeKalifornication procedure. Is this just another vent line that I leave alone or did I miss something? 2) While attempting the stock muffler cleanout today I broke off the head of the forward cleanout screw. Compressed oatmeal strikes again. Anyone else just leave the threaded shaft in there? I replaced the rear with a new one installed with a good glop of antiseize. 3)I didn't notice anything coming out the cleanout hole when I covered the exhaust and tapped the muffler with a mallet, but I wasn't running the throttle up as I needed 3 hands to do throttle, mallet, and plug the exhaust. Is this cleanout useless or should I do it again? Edmund A17 in the GI Joe colors
